The post-pandemic home office has graduated from a temporary arrangement to a permanent room with permanent design standards. The 2026 home office rejects the sterile "productivity pod" aesthetic in favor of spaces that feel warm, focused, and human. Warm wood desks replace cold white laminate. Warm-toned walls (sage green, warm beige, or soft terracotta) replace stark white, providing visual warmth during long hours. Biophilic elements — plants, natural light maximization, and natural materials — support focus and reduce fatigue. Task lighting has become more sophisticated: adjustable desk lamps in warm brass, backlit shelving, and layered ambient lighting replace single overhead fixtures.

Perguntas Frequentes
What is the best wall color for a home office in 2026?
Sage green is the most popular — research shows green tones support focus and reduce eye strain. Warm beige, soft terracotta, and dusty blue are strong alternatives. The key is choosing a color with warm undertones that does not fatigue the eye over long hours.
How do I make a small home office look stylish?
Focus on one quality desk in warm wood, a comfortable chair with visual appeal, and curated wall shelving. Minimize visible cables and electronics. Add a single plant and a quality desk lamp. Restraint is the key in small spaces — fewer, better items look more designed.
What desk style is trending for home offices?
Warm wood desks with clean lines — particularly walnut and white oak — are the dominant trend. Desks with subtle rounded edges or tapered legs add warmth. The standing desk format is mature, with warm wood standing desks now widely available.
